4.3.2 Dielectric strength
The 1500V, 50Hz AC voltage shall be subjected to among the power phase, the
medium connecting line and casing of the instrument; there is no breakdown or arc-
over phenomena for 1min.
4.3.3 Protective grounding
The protection connection impedance of the instrument shall be no greater than 0.1Ω.
4.3.4 Safety protection sign of the instrument
For the instruments equipped with radioactive source detector, there shall have
radioactive source safety pattern and sign on the outside; the high-temperature heating
zone of the instrument shall have an anti-scald mark.
4.4 Sealing for airway system
4.4.1 Sealing for airway system of carrier gas
Under the condition of room temperature, the pressure drop within 30min is no greater
than 0.01MPa under the hydrogen pressure of 0.3MPa.
4.4.2 Sealing for airway system of fuel gas
Under the condition of room temperature, the pressure drop within 30min is no greater
than 0.01MPa under the hydrogen pressure of 0.3MPa.
4.4.3 Sealing for airway system of combustion-supporting gas
Under the condition of room temperature, the pressure drop within 30min is no greater
than 0.01MPa under the air pressure of 0.3MPa.
4.5 Column heater temperature control system
4.5.1 Temperature control range. 20°C~350°C above the room temperature.
4.5.2 Temperature stability. no greater than 0.5%.
4.5.3 Temperature gradient. no greater than 2.5%.
4.5.4 Minimum adjustment of the setting temperature. no greater than 1°C.
4.5.5 The deviation between the setting temperature and actual temperature shall not
exceed ±3%.
4.5.6 Programmed temperature-rise repeatability. no greater than 1%.

5.3.2 Dielectric strength
The power plug of the instrument shall not connect to the power grid; connect the high-
voltage output line of the withstand voltage tester with the live and neutral lines of the
instrument power plug; the low-potential output line (black) is connected to the
protective grounding terminal of the instrument power plug. Turn on the power switch
of the instrument; turn on the withstand voltage tester to increase the voltage gradually
to 1500V; keep for 1min; all parts of the instrument have no breakdown or arc-over
phenomena.
5.3.3 Protective grounding
It shall be performed as stipulated in 6.5.1.3 of GB 4793.1-2007.
5.3.4 Safety protection sign of the instrument
Visual inspection.
5.4 Sealing of airway system
5.4.1 Sealing for airway system of carrier gas
Connect the chromatographic column to the detector; block the outlet; connect the
pressure gauge to the system; inject the carrier gas (hydrogen) as per the analysis
procedure; use the regulating value to make the pressure behind the valve 0.3MPa;
shut off the gas source; make system stabilize for 5min; observe the pressure drop
after 30min.
